@import"https://fonts.googleapis.com/css2?family=Instrument+Serif:ital@0;1&family=JetBrains+Mono:wght@400;500;600&family=DM+Sans:wght@400;500;600&display=swap";.dtf-gc-wrapper{--dtf-bg: #0c0c0d;--dtf-bg-elev: #141416;--dtf-bg-elev-2: #1c1c1f;--dtf-line: #2a2a2e;--dtf-line-strong: #3a3a40;--dtf-fg: #f4f4f5;--dtf-fg-dim: #a1a1aa;--dtf-fg-muted: #6b6b73;--dtf-cyan: #00b3d9;--dtf-magenta: #e83e8c;--dtf-yellow: #e8c547;--dtf-danger: #ff3a3a;--dtf-success: #4ade80;background:var(--dtf-bg);color:var(--dtf-fg);font-family:DM Sans,sans-serif;-webkit-font-smoothing:antialiased;padding:48px 0 64px;background-image:radial-gradient(circle at 0% 0%,rgba(0,179,217,.06),transparent 40%),radial-gradient(circle at 100% 100%,rgba(232,62,140,.05),transparent 40%)}.dtf-gc-wrapper *,.dtf-gc-wrapper *:before,.dtf-gc-wrapper *:after{box-sizing:border-box}.dtf-gc-container{max-width:1400px;margin:0 auto;padding:0 32px}@media(max-width:600px){.dtf-gc-container{padding:0 16px}.dtf-gc-wrapper{padding:24px 0}}.dtf-gc-header{margin-bottom:40px;display:flex;justify-content:space-between;align-items:flex-end;gap:32px;flex-wrap:wrap}.dtf-gc-title{font-family:"Instrument Serif",serif;font-size:clamp(36px,5vw,60px);font-weight:400;line-height:1;letter-spacing:-.02em;color:var(--dtf-fg);margin:0}.dtf-gc-title em{font-style:italic;color:var(--dtf-cyan)}.dtf-gc-subtitle{font-size:14px;color:var(--dtf-fg-dim);margin-top:16px;max-width:600px;line-height:1.55}.dtf-gc-subtitle p{margin:0 0 8px}.dtf-gc-subtitle p:last-child{margin:0}.dtf-gc-badge-row{display:flex;gap:8px;font-family:JetBrains Mono,monospace;font-size:11px;text-transform:uppercase;letter-spacing:.08em;flex-wrap:wrap}.dtf-gc-badge{padding:6px 12px;border:1px solid var(--dtf-line);border-radius:999px;color:var(--dtf-fg-dim);display:inline-flex;align-items:center}.dtf-gc-dot{display:inline-block;width:6px;height:6px;border-radius:50%;margin-right:8px}.dtf-gc-badge-cmyk .dtf-gc-dot{background:var(--dtf-success)}.dtf-gc-badge-pro .dtf-gc-dot{background:var(--dtf-cyan)}.dtf-gc-badge-out .dtf-gc-dot{background:var(--dtf-danger)}.dtf-gc-drop-zone{border:1.5px dashed var(--dtf-line-strong);border-radius:8px;padding:64px 32px;text-align:center;cursor:pointer;transition:all .2s ease;background:var(--dtf-bg-elev);margin-bottom:32px}.dtf-gc-drop-zone:hover,.dtf-gc-drop-zone.dtf-gc-dragging{border-color:var(--dtf-cyan);background:var(--dtf-bg-elev-2)}.dtf-gc-drop-icon{font-family:"Instrument Serif",serif;font-style:italic;font-size:48px;color:var(--dtf-fg-muted);margin-bottom:12px;line-height:1}.dtf-gc-drop-text{font-size:16px;color:var(--dtf-fg);margin-bottom:6px}.dtf-gc-drop-hint{font-family:JetBrains Mono,monospace;font-size:11px;color:var(--dtf-fg-muted);text-transform:uppercase;letter-spacing:.08em}.dtf-gc-controls{display:none!important}.dtf-gc-btn{background:var(--dtf-fg);color:var(--dtf-bg);border:none;padding:10px 20px;font-family:JetBrains Mono,monospace;font-size:11px;text-transform:uppercase;letter-spacing:.08em;border-radius:6px;cursor:pointer;transition:opacity .15s}.dtf-gc-btn:hover{opacity:.8}.dtf-gc-btn-secondary{background:transparent;color:var(--dtf-fg);border:1px solid var(--dtf-line-strong)}.dtf-gc-results{display:none;grid-template-columns:1fr 380px;gap:24px}.dtf-gc-results.dtf-gc-visible{display:grid}@media(max-width:1000px){.dtf-gc-results.dtf-gc-visible{grid-template-columns:1fr}}.dtf-gc-canvas-section{background:var(--dtf-bg-elev);border:1px solid var(--dtf-line);border-radius:8px;overflow:hidden}.dtf-gc-canvas-tabs{display:flex;border-bottom:1px solid var(--dtf-line);overflow-x:auto}.dtf-gc-tab{flex:1;padding:14px 16px;font-family:JetBrains Mono,monospace;font-size:10px;text-transform:uppercase;letter-spacing:.08em;background:transparent;color:var(--dtf-fg-dim);border:none;cursor:pointer;border-bottom:2px solid transparent;transition:all .15s;white-space:nowrap}.dtf-gc-tab-active{color:var(--dtf-fg);border-bottom-color:var(--dtf-cyan)}.dtf-gc-tab:hover:not(.dtf-gc-tab-active){color:var(--dtf-fg)}.dtf-gc-canvas-wrap{padding:32px;display:flex;justify-content:center;align-items:center;min-height:400px;background-image:linear-gradient(45deg,#1a1a1c 25%,transparent 25%),linear-gradient(-45deg,#1a1a1c 25%,transparent 25%),linear-gradient(45deg,transparent 75%,#1a1a1c 75%),linear-gradient(-45deg,transparent 75%,#1a1a1c 75%);background-size:20px 20px;background-position:0 0,0 10px,10px -10px,-10px 0px}.dtf-gc-canvas-wrap canvas{max-width:100%;max-height:70vh;image-rendering:pixelated;box-shadow:0 8px 32px #0006;display:block}.dtf-gc-legend{display:flex;gap:16px;padding:12px 24px;background:var(--dtf-bg-elev-2);border-top:1px solid var(--dtf-line);font-family:JetBrains Mono,monospace;font-size:10px;color:var(--dtf-fg-dim);flex-wrap:wrap;text-transform:uppercase;letter-spacing:.06em}.dtf-gc-legend-item{display:flex;align-items:center;gap:8px}.dtf-gc-legend-swatch{width:12px;height:12px;border-radius:3px;border:1px solid var(--dtf-line)}.dtf-gc-sidebar{display:flex;flex-direction:column;gap:16px}.dtf-gc-stats-grid{display:grid;grid-template-columns:repeat(3,1fr);gap:8px}@media(max-width:768px){.dtf-gc-stats-grid{grid-template-columns:1fr}}.dtf-gc-stat-card{background:var(--dtf-bg-elev);border:1px solid var(--dtf-line);border-radius:8px;padding:12px 10px}.dtf-gc-stat-label{font-family:JetBrains Mono,monospace;font-size:8.5px;text-transform:uppercase;letter-spacing:.08em;color:var(--dtf-fg-muted);margin-bottom:6px}.dtf-gc-stat-value{font-family:"Instrument Serif",serif;font-size:24px;line-height:1;letter-spacing:-.02em;margin-bottom:8px}.dtf-gc-stat-bar{height:3px;background:var(--dtf-line);border-radius:2px;overflow:hidden}.dtf-gc-stat-bar-fill{height:100%;width:0%;transition:width .3s ease}.dtf-gc-verdict{padding:16px 20px;border-radius:8px;border:1px solid var(--dtf-line);font-size:13px;line-height:1.5;background:var(--dtf-bg-elev)}.dtf-gc-verdict.dtf-gc-verdict-good{background:#4ade800d;border-color:#4ade804d;color:var(--dtf-success)}.dtf-gc-verdict.dtf-gc-verdict-pro{background:#00b3d90d;border-color:#00b3d94d;color:var(--dtf-cyan)}.dtf-gc-verdict.dtf-gc-verdict-warn{background:#e8c5470d;border-color:#e8c5474d;color:var(--dtf-yellow)}.dtf-gc-verdict.dtf-gc-verdict-bad{background:#ff3a3a0d;border-color:#ff3a3a4d;color:var(--dtf-danger)}.dtf-gc-color-section{background:var(--dtf-bg-elev);border:1px solid var(--dtf-line);border-radius:8px;overflow:hidden}.dtf-gc-color-section-header{padding:14px 20px;border-bottom:1px solid var(--dtf-line);font-family:JetBrains Mono,monospace;font-size:10px;text-transform:uppercase;letter-spacing:.08em;color:var(--dtf-fg-dim);display:flex;justify-content:space-between;align-items:center}.dtf-gc-color-section-title{display:flex;align-items:center;gap:8px;color:var(--dtf-fg)}.dtf-gc-color-section-dot{width:8px;height:8px;border-radius:50%;display:inline-block}.dtf-gc-color-list{max-height:320px;overflow-y:auto}.dtf-gc-color-list::-webkit-scrollbar{width:8px}.dtf-gc-color-list::-webkit-scrollbar-track{background:var(--dtf-bg-elev)}.dtf-gc-color-list::-webkit-scrollbar-thumb{background:var(--dtf-line-strong);border-radius:4px}.dtf-gc-color-row{display:flex;align-items:center;padding:10px 16px;border-bottom:1px solid var(--dtf-line);gap:12px;transition:background .1s}.dtf-gc-color-row:last-child{border-bottom:none}.dtf-gc-color-row:hover{background:var(--dtf-bg-elev-2)}.dtf-gc-swatches{display:flex;align-items:center;gap:4px;flex-shrink:0}.dtf-gc-swatch{width:28px;height:28px;border-radius:5px;border:1px solid var(--dtf-line-strong)}.dtf-gc-swatch-arrow{font-family:JetBrains Mono,monospace;font-size:11px;color:var(--dtf-fg-muted);margin:0 2px}.dtf-gc-color-info{flex:1;min-width:0}.dtf-gc-color-hex{font-family:JetBrains Mono,monospace;font-size:12px;font-weight:500;color:var(--dtf-fg)}.dtf-gc-color-hex-mapped{color:var(--dtf-fg-muted);font-size:10px}.dtf-gc-color-meta{font-family:JetBrains Mono,monospace;font-size:9px;color:var(--dtf-fg-muted);margin-top:2px;text-transform:uppercase;letter-spacing:.06em}.dtf-gc-color-pct{font-family:JetBrains Mono,monospace;font-size:11px;color:var(--dtf-fg-dim);flex-shrink:0}.dtf-gc-empty{padding:32px 20px;text-align:center;color:var(--dtf-fg-muted);font-style:italic;font-family:"Instrument Serif",serif;font-size:16px}.dtf-gc-footer{margin-top:48px;padding-top:32px;border-top:1px solid var(--dtf-line);font-family:JetBrains Mono,monospace;font-size:11px;color:var(--dtf-fg-muted);line-height:1.6}.dtf-gc-footer p{margin:0 0 8px}.dtf-gc-footer p:last-child{margin:0}
/*# sourceMappingURL=/cdn/shop/t/68/compiled_assets/styles.css.map */
